Smart Contracts and Their Applications

Smart contracts are self-executing agreements with the terms directly written into code. They operate on blockchain technology, ensuring transparency and security. This eliminates the need for intermediaries, which can reduce costs and increase efficiency. Efficiency is crucial in business operations.

Recent advancements have enhanced the functionality of smart contracts, allowing for more complex applications. For instance, they can automate processes in various industries, including finance, real estate, and supply chain management. Automation saves time and resources. Additionally, smart contracts can facilitate trust between parties by providing verifiable and tamper-proof records. Trust is essential in any transaction.

Decentralized Applications (dApps) and Their Impact

Decentralized applications, or dApps, leverage blockchain technology to operate without a central authority. This structure enhances security and user control over data. Users appreciate increased privacy. Recent advancements have improved the scalability and usability of dApps, making them more accessible to a broader audience. Accessibility is essential for widespread adoption.

Furthermore, dApps can facilitate peer-to-peer transactions, reducing reliance on traditional financial institutions. This shift can lower transaction costs and increase transaction speed. Speed matters in financial operations. Additionally, the integration of decentralized finance (DeFi) within dApps has opened new avenues for investment and lending. Challenges in Integration

Integrating blockchain technology with existing software solutions presents several challenges. One significant issue is the compatibility of legacy systems with new blockchain frameworks. Many organizations rely on outdated software, which may not support blockchaig integration. This can lead to increased costs and extended timelines. Costs can escalate quickly.

Additionally, there is often a lack of understanding among stakeholders regarding blockchain’s capabilities and limitations. This knowledge gap can hinder effective decision-making and implementation. Education is crucial for successful integration. Furthermore, regulatory compliance poses another challenge, as blockchain operates in a rapidly evolving legal landscape. Navigating these regulations can be complex.
